Skip to main content
studio office for sale neapolis limassol 1317178 image 2572055
studio office for sale neapolis limassol 1317178 image 2572053
studio office for sale neapolis limassol 1317178 image 2572051
studio office for sale neapolis limassol 1317178 image 2572048
studio office for sale neapolis limassol 1317178 image 2572045
studio office for sale neapolis limassol 1317178 image 2572042
studio office for sale neapolis limassol 1317178 image 2572039